The marine industry plays a vital role in the use of metal ropes, especially in sectors involving offshore oil and gas exploration, maritime transport, and cargo handling. Metal ropes are extensively employed in cranes, winches, and hoisting systems, where reliability is paramount. Non-destructive testing in this sector is employed to ensure the ropes are free from defects that could result in equipment failure or safety hazards. Techniques such as visual inspection, ultrasonic testing, and magnetic particle inspection are commonly used to detect corrosion, fatigue, and wear in these critical components. With the maritime industry focusing on enhancing safety protocols, NDT is increasingly being recognized as an essential tool for preventative maintenance in rope systems.
Furthermore, the rigorous environmental conditions at sea, including exposure to saltwater and high humidity, can significantly impact the longevity and performance of metal ropes. As such, NDT methods are not only employed to detect visible damage but also to assess potential underlying issues that could compromise the rope's structural integrity. Preventative maintenance programs based on regular NDT inspections help reduce unexpected downtime and avoid catastrophic failures. These proactive measures are in line with the marine industry’s growing emphasis on safety and operational efficiency, further driving the demand for NDT in metal rope applications.
The construction industry is another major segment driving the Europe metal rope NDT market. Metal ropes are integral to construction operations, especially in high-rise building construction, bridge construction, and heavy lifting applications. These ropes are used in cranes, hoists, and suspension systems, where their failure could lead to catastrophic consequences, including structural collapse or serious injuries. Non-destructive testing in the construction industry helps ensure that the metal ropes meet the required safety standards and are free of damage that could affect their performance. Through regular NDT inspections, defects such as cracks, corrosion, or elongation can be detected early, allowing for timely repairs or replacements and maintaining the safety and integrity of construction operations.
The increasing trend towards high-rise buildings and large infrastructure projects further propels the need for stringent safety regulations and maintenance practices. NDT methods, including eddy current testing and acoustic emission testing, are becoming increasingly popular in construction projects to ensure the ropes' reliability under extreme load conditions. Additionally, the growing adoption of smart sensors and advanced technologies in the construction industry is helping to automate and enhance the accuracy of NDT procedures, ensuring that safety standards are consistently met and reducing the risk of costly delays caused by rope failures.
Other industries, such as mining, aerospace, and energy, also rely on metal ropes for various critical applications. In the mining sector, metal ropes are used for material handling, transportation, and hoisting systems, often in harsh environments where wear and tear can compromise rope integrity. NDT in these applications ensures the ropes are functioning as expected and prevents costly accidents. Similarly, in the aerospace sector, metal ropes are used in elevators, control systems, and hoists, where failure could jeopardize the safety of both personnel and equipment. The energy sector, especially wind energy, also depends on metal ropes for lifting and securing heavy equipment. Non-destructive testing techniques in these industries help detect early signs of stress or wear that could lead to system failures, thereby improving operational efficiency and safety.
